Output e50ab0d5ecaa4c0f9876d37284c58c97ff52b8e0d4529f49fb3cced0039e9ce3:0

value
180765260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ede1b68b76d0ef72db6ea9b4a29f8030bc02e0 OP_EQUAL
address
34nRCBcjzU9xZTMoG1tJcUHsFzjJ5tyudL
transaction
e50ab0d5ecaa4c0f9876d37284c58c97ff52b8e0d4529f49fb3cced0039e9ce3
spent
true